Why a browser extension is not enough

Blocking Google in a browser stops the pages you visit. It does not stop an Android phone checking in, a smart speaker reporting back, a television resolving an advertising domain, or any of the analytics and font and tag endpoints embedded in other people’s websites. Those requests are made by the operating system and by apps, not by a tab.

DNS filtering happens before any of it. Every device has to resolve a domain before it can reach it, so a rule set once applies to everything on that device — including software with no settings of its own.

What the De-Google list covers

Thousands of domains spanning search, advertising and analytics, YouTube, Android services, Fonts, reCAPTCHA, Firebase, DoubleClick, Google Cloud endpoints used for telemetry, and the country-specific search domains that are otherwise easy to miss.

It sits alongside De-Apple and De-Microsoft, so a device can be cut off from one vendor, or from several, without touching anything else you have blocked.

Decide how far you want to go

De-Google is deliberately thorough, and thorough has consequences. Blocking Alphabet outright will break sign-in with Google on third-party sites, embedded YouTube video, reCAPTCHA challenges on forms, Google Fonts on sites that load them, and Play Store functions on an Android device.

Two ways to live with that. Apply it to one profile — a media device, a spare phone, a browser machine — and leave your everyday device alone. Or apply it broadly and use custom rules to allow back the handful of domains you actually need, which is how most people end up running it.

If what you want is the tracking rather than the whole company, the filtering categories block Google’s advertising and analytics domains while leaving its products working.

What to allow back, and what it restores

These are the exceptions people reach for most often. Add them as allow rules on the profile running De-Google — the list is a starting point rather than a complete set, and the right answer is whichever of these you actually use.

The distinction worth holding on to is between services you choose to use and services that run behind your back. Allowing YouTube means YouTube knows you watched something, which you knew when you pressed play. It does not put Google Fonts, Tag Manager, DoubleClick or Analytics back on every unrelated site you visit — those stay blocked, and they are the reason to run this at all.

Push notifications on Android

The single most disruptive thing to lose, and the least obvious. Every Android app that notifies you goes through this one host — messaging, banking, deliveries, alarms. Blocked, they simply stop arriving, with nothing to indicate why.

mtalk.google.com*mtalk.google.com

Android reporting the network as working

Android decides whether a network has internet by fetching this. Blocked, the phone shows "no internet" and may refuse to stay on Wi-Fi at all, even though everything else is fine.

connectivitycheck.gstatic.com

Google Search — and reCAPTCHA with it

Allowing the search host also restores the reCAPTCHA challenges that sit on other people’s sign-up and contact forms, because they are served from the same place. That is usually the reason a form silently refuses to submit.

www.google.com

YouTube

The page, the video streams and the thumbnails are all on separate hosts, so allowing only the first gets you a player that never starts.

www.youtube.comm.youtube.comyoutu.be*.googlevideo.com*.ytimg.com

Gmail

Web and app access to an existing mailbox.

*.gmail.com

RSS feeds published through FeedBurner

A long tail of blogs and podcasts still serve their feed this way, and a reader will look broken rather than blocked.

feeds.feedburner.comfeedproxy.google.com

Setting it up

Enable the De-Google category on a profile, then point a device at that profile’s resolver address. Nothing is installed, and the change applies to the device immediately.

The per-platform steps are on the setup page. If you want the whole household covered, set it on the router; if you want it to follow a device off the network, set it on the device itself.
